How much does it cost to rent an apartment in 30043?
| Bedroom | Average Rent | Cheapest Rent | Highest Rent |
|---|---|---|---|
| 30043 Studio Apartments | $1,547 | $1,149 | $2,712 |
| 30043 1 Bedroom Apartments | $1,702 | $945 | $5,479 |
| 30043 2 Bedroom Apartments | $2,074 | $988 | $5,602 |
| 30043 3 Bedroom Apartments | $2,331 | $1,361 | $7,216 |
| 30043 4 Bedroom Apartments | $2,985 | $1,876 | $4,991 |
